Transaction 42a989dcb4adeda37e808dcd495a8da8944515af39f8de62668969dd0bae9ab8

2 Input
2 Outputs
  • 42a989dcb4adeda37e808dcd495a8da8944515af39f8de62668969dd0bae9ab8:0
  • value  17636400
    address  3JHr9ApK9cjjmGDRD3CUEjxfSGDzvDvLmV
  • 42a989dcb4adeda37e808dcd495a8da8944515af39f8de62668969dd0bae9ab8:1
  • value  396800952
    address  3Fa6gDdmGLThLGRtJVg6CVMkoEp26gC2Dk